How To Fix /ACCGO/BR_UIS007 - Brazil: company is not authorized to split scenario to LDC


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: /ACCGO/BR_UIS -

  • Message number: 007

  • Message text: Brazil: company is not authorized to split scenario to LDC

    The SAP error message /ACCGO/BR_UIS007 indicates that a company is not authorized to split a scenario to LDC (Local Distribution Company) in the context of Brazilian tax and accounting regulations. This error typically arises in the SAP system when dealing with Brazilian localization, particularly in the area of tax compliance and reporting.

    Cause:

    1. Authorization Issues: The company code or the user may not have the necessary authorizations to perform the split scenario operation.
    2. Configuration Settings: The system may not be properly configured to allow the splitting of scenarios for the specific company code.
    3. Missing Master Data: There may be missing or incorrect master data related to the company code or the LDC.
    4. Legal Requirements: The company may not meet the legal requirements to perform the operation in question, as per Brazilian regulations.

    Solution:

    1. Check Authorizations: Ensure that the user has the necessary authorizations to perform the operation. This may involve checking user roles and permissions in the SAP system.
    2. Review Configuration: Verify the configuration settings for the company code in the SAP system. This includes checking the settings related to tax and accounting for Brazilian localization.
    3. Update Master Data: Ensure that all relevant master data is correctly maintained. This includes company code settings, tax codes, and any other related data.
    4. Consult Documentation: Review SAP documentation or notes related to the error message for any specific guidance or updates that may be relevant.
    5. Contact SAP Support: If the issue persists, consider reaching out to SAP support for assistance. They may provide insights or patches that address the issue.
